140 lines
4.4 KiB
C
140 lines
4.4 KiB
C
/* ************************************************************************** */
|
|
/* */
|
|
/* ::: :::::::: */
|
|
/* small_parse_table_1635.c :+: :+: :+: */
|
|
/* +:+ +:+ +:+ */
|
|
/* By: maiboyer <maiboyer@student.42.fr> +#+ +:+ +#+ */
|
|
/* +#+#+#+#+#+ +#+ */
|
|
/* Created: 2024/04/14 19:17:54 by maiboyer #+# #+# */
|
|
/* Updated: 2024/04/14 19:18:20 by maiboyer ### ########.fr */
|
|
/* */
|
|
/* ************************************************************************** */
|
|
|
|
#include "./small_parse_table.h"
|
|
|
|
void small_parse_table_8175(t_small_parse_table_array *v)
|
|
{
|
|
v->a[163500] = anon_sym_GT_EQ;
|
|
v->a[163501] = anon_sym_LT_LT;
|
|
v->a[163502] = anon_sym_GT_GT;
|
|
v->a[163503] = anon_sym_PLUS;
|
|
v->a[163504] = anon_sym_DASH;
|
|
v->a[163505] = anon_sym_STAR;
|
|
v->a[163506] = anon_sym_SLASH;
|
|
v->a[163507] = anon_sym_PERCENT;
|
|
v->a[163508] = anon_sym_STAR_STAR;
|
|
v->a[163509] = 5;
|
|
v->a[163510] = actions(71);
|
|
v->a[163511] = 1;
|
|
v->a[163512] = sym_comment;
|
|
v->a[163513] = actions(7430);
|
|
v->a[163514] = 1;
|
|
v->a[163515] = anon_sym_STAR_STAR;
|
|
v->a[163516] = actions(7404);
|
|
v->a[163517] = 2;
|
|
v->a[163518] = anon_sym_PLUS_PLUS;
|
|
v->a[163519] = anon_sym_DASH_DASH;
|
|
small_parse_table_8176(v);
|
|
}
|
|
|
|
void small_parse_table_8176(t_small_parse_table_array *v)
|
|
{
|
|
v->a[163520] = actions(6807);
|
|
v->a[163521] = 13;
|
|
v->a[163522] = anon_sym_EQ;
|
|
v->a[163523] = anon_sym_PIPE;
|
|
v->a[163524] = anon_sym_CARET;
|
|
v->a[163525] = anon_sym_AMP;
|
|
v->a[163526] = anon_sym_LT;
|
|
v->a[163527] = anon_sym_GT;
|
|
v->a[163528] = anon_sym_LT_LT;
|
|
v->a[163529] = anon_sym_GT_GT;
|
|
v->a[163530] = anon_sym_PLUS;
|
|
v->a[163531] = anon_sym_DASH;
|
|
v->a[163532] = anon_sym_STAR;
|
|
v->a[163533] = anon_sym_SLASH;
|
|
v->a[163534] = anon_sym_PERCENT;
|
|
v->a[163535] = actions(6805);
|
|
v->a[163536] = 21;
|
|
v->a[163537] = sym_test_operator;
|
|
v->a[163538] = anon_sym_PLUS_EQ;
|
|
v->a[163539] = anon_sym_DASH_EQ;
|
|
small_parse_table_8177(v);
|
|
}
|
|
|
|
void small_parse_table_8177(t_small_parse_table_array *v)
|
|
{
|
|
v->a[163540] = anon_sym_STAR_EQ;
|
|
v->a[163541] = anon_sym_SLASH_EQ;
|
|
v->a[163542] = anon_sym_PERCENT_EQ;
|
|
v->a[163543] = anon_sym_STAR_STAR_EQ;
|
|
v->a[163544] = anon_sym_LT_LT_EQ;
|
|
v->a[163545] = anon_sym_GT_GT_EQ;
|
|
v->a[163546] = anon_sym_AMP_EQ;
|
|
v->a[163547] = anon_sym_CARET_EQ;
|
|
v->a[163548] = anon_sym_PIPE_EQ;
|
|
v->a[163549] = anon_sym_PIPE_PIPE;
|
|
v->a[163550] = anon_sym_AMP_AMP;
|
|
v->a[163551] = anon_sym_EQ_EQ;
|
|
v->a[163552] = anon_sym_BANG_EQ;
|
|
v->a[163553] = anon_sym_LT_EQ;
|
|
v->a[163554] = anon_sym_GT_EQ;
|
|
v->a[163555] = anon_sym_RPAREN;
|
|
v->a[163556] = anon_sym_EQ_TILDE;
|
|
v->a[163557] = anon_sym_QMARK;
|
|
v->a[163558] = 5;
|
|
v->a[163559] = actions(71);
|
|
small_parse_table_8178(v);
|
|
}
|
|
|
|
void small_parse_table_8178(t_small_parse_table_array *v)
|
|
{
|
|
v->a[163560] = 1;
|
|
v->a[163561] = sym_comment;
|
|
v->a[163562] = actions(7430);
|
|
v->a[163563] = 1;
|
|
v->a[163564] = anon_sym_STAR_STAR;
|
|
v->a[163565] = actions(7404);
|
|
v->a[163566] = 2;
|
|
v->a[163567] = anon_sym_PLUS_PLUS;
|
|
v->a[163568] = anon_sym_DASH_DASH;
|
|
v->a[163569] = actions(6807);
|
|
v->a[163570] = 13;
|
|
v->a[163571] = anon_sym_EQ;
|
|
v->a[163572] = anon_sym_PIPE;
|
|
v->a[163573] = anon_sym_CARET;
|
|
v->a[163574] = anon_sym_AMP;
|
|
v->a[163575] = anon_sym_LT;
|
|
v->a[163576] = anon_sym_GT;
|
|
v->a[163577] = anon_sym_LT_LT;
|
|
v->a[163578] = anon_sym_GT_GT;
|
|
v->a[163579] = anon_sym_PLUS;
|
|
small_parse_table_8179(v);
|
|
}
|
|
|
|
void small_parse_table_8179(t_small_parse_table_array *v)
|
|
{
|
|
v->a[163580] = anon_sym_DASH;
|
|
v->a[163581] = anon_sym_STAR;
|
|
v->a[163582] = anon_sym_SLASH;
|
|
v->a[163583] = anon_sym_PERCENT;
|
|
v->a[163584] = actions(6805);
|
|
v->a[163585] = 21;
|
|
v->a[163586] = sym_test_operator;
|
|
v->a[163587] = anon_sym_PLUS_EQ;
|
|
v->a[163588] = anon_sym_DASH_EQ;
|
|
v->a[163589] = anon_sym_STAR_EQ;
|
|
v->a[163590] = anon_sym_SLASH_EQ;
|
|
v->a[163591] = anon_sym_PERCENT_EQ;
|
|
v->a[163592] = anon_sym_STAR_STAR_EQ;
|
|
v->a[163593] = anon_sym_LT_LT_EQ;
|
|
v->a[163594] = anon_sym_GT_GT_EQ;
|
|
v->a[163595] = anon_sym_AMP_EQ;
|
|
v->a[163596] = anon_sym_CARET_EQ;
|
|
v->a[163597] = anon_sym_PIPE_EQ;
|
|
v->a[163598] = anon_sym_PIPE_PIPE;
|
|
v->a[163599] = anon_sym_AMP_AMP;
|
|
small_parse_table_8180(v);
|
|
}
|
|
|
|
/* EOF small_parse_table_1635.c */
|